The Essential Function of Truck Exhaust Mufflers in Mitigating Noise Pollution


Introduction to Truck Exhaust Mufflers


In the realm of automotive engineering, the **truck exhaust muffler** is a pivotal component designed to minimize noise pollution emitted from heavy-duty vehicles. As cities expand and traffic congestion increases, the **demand for quieter environments** has surged. Understanding the functionality and significance of exhaust mufflers in trucks becomes paramount for manufacturers, drivers, and environmental advocates alike.

What Is a Truck Exhaust Muffler?


A truck exhaust muffler is a device integrated into the exhaust system of a truck, primarily aimed at reducing the noise produced by the engine's exhaust gases. This component operates by redirecting and dissipating sound waves through a series of chambers, ultimately lowering the overall noise output. The design and technology behind mufflers have evolved significantly over the years, leading to more efficient and effective noise reduction systems.

The Anatomy of a Muffler


To appreciate how mufflers function, it is essential to understand their construction. A typical truck muffler comprises the following parts:

  • Inlet Pipe: The entry point for exhaust gases from the engine.

  • Chambers: Various compartments that serve to diffuse and reflect sound waves.

  • Outlet Pipe: The exit point where reduced noise exhaust gases exit the muffler.

  • Material: Mufflers are often made from stainless steel, aluminum, or other durable materials to withstand high temperatures and corrosive elements.


Types of Mufflers


There are several types of exhaust mufflers, each with unique designs and sound-dampening capabilities. The primary types include:

  • Reflective Mufflers: Utilize sound wave reflection to cancel out specific frequencies, providing a quieter ride.

  • Absorption Mufflers: Employ sound-absorbing materials to dampen noise without significant back pressure.

  • Turbo Mufflers: Designed for performance vehicles, these mufflers balance noise reduction with increased exhaust flow.


How Truck Mufflers Reduce Noise Pollution


The mechanism by which truck exhaust mufflers operate involves the reduction of sound wave intensity through various engineering principles. By analyzing these principles, we can better understand their contribution to **noise pollution reduction**.

Sound Wave Interference


One of the primary methods mufflers use to mitigate noise is through **sound wave interference**. The design allows for the cancellation of certain sound frequencies, effectively reducing the overall noise level. As exhaust gases pass through the muffler, the sound waves collide with each other, leading to destructive interference that diminishes their intensity.

Expansion of Gases


When exhaust gases enter the muffler, they encounter a series of expanding chambers. As the gases expand, the speed reduces, and in doing so, the noise generated by the exhaust is significantly lowered. This principle is vital in ensuring that heavy-duty vehicles contribute less to environmental noise.

The Environmental Impact of Noise Pollution


The repercussions of noise pollution extend beyond mere annoyance; they pose significant risks to human health and the environment. High levels of noise can lead to stress, sleep disturbances, and cardiovascular issues. Moreover, wildlife is adversely affected, disrupting natural habitats and behaviors.

Regulatory Standards and Compliance


Governments worldwide recognize the impact of noise pollution, leading to the establishment of regulatory standards governing vehicle emissions and noise levels. Compliance with these regulations is essential for trucking companies, as failing to adhere can result in hefty fines and reputational damage. The implementation of effective exhaust mufflers is a crucial step toward compliance.

Benefits of Efficient Muffler Systems


Investing in high-quality truck exhaust mufflers offers numerous benefits beyond noise reduction. These include:

Improved Vehicle Performance


A well-designed muffler can enhance engine performance by optimizing exhaust flow. This leads to better fuel efficiency and increased power output, making trucks more economical and environmentally friendly.

Community Well-Being


With the growing concerns surrounding urban noise, effective muffler systems contribute to the well-being of communities. Reduced noise levels lead to a better quality of life for residents, minimizing stress and health-related issues associated with constant noise exposure.

Longevity of Truck Components


A quieter engine translates to less vibration and strain on vehicle components. This means that other parts of the truck can experience less wear and tear, ultimately extending their lifespan and reducing maintenance costs.

Innovations in Muffler Technology


As technology advances, so does the design and efficiency of truck exhaust mufflers. Some recent innovations include:

Active Noise Control Systems


These systems utilize electronic sensors and actuators to identify noise frequencies and adjust the muffler's operation accordingly. By dynamically altering how sound waves are managed, these systems offer superior noise reduction.

Eco-Friendly Mufflers


With the rise of environmental awareness, manufacturers are developing mufflers that not only reduce noise but also lower emissions. These eco-friendly mufflers help to minimize the environmental footprint of heavy-duty vehicles, aligning with global sustainability goals.

FAQs About Truck Exhaust Mufflers


1. How often should I replace my truck’s muffler?


It is advisable to check your muffler annually, especially if you notice any changes in noise levels or exhaust performance. Generally, a muffler can last anywhere from 5 to 10 years, depending on usage and maintenance.

2. Can a muffler affect fuel efficiency?


Yes, a properly functioning muffler can enhance fuel efficiency by ensuring optimal exhaust flow and reducing back pressure.

3. What are the signs of a failing muffler?


Common signs include loud exhaust noise, a decrease in engine performance, and visible rust or damage on the muffler.

4. Are there legal requirements for mufflers?


Yes, noise and emission regulations vary by region. It is crucial to ensure your vehicle complies with local laws to avoid penalties.

5. Can I modify my truck's muffler for better performance?


While modifications can enhance performance, it's essential to ensure that any changes comply with local regulations to avoid legal issues.
